Team,

The migration of event schemas from Larkwell's legacy manifest store to the new Quillcrest Registry finished last night. All producers now validate against registry-pinned versions, and the compatibility mode is set to backward-transitive. Write access is restricted to the pipeline service account; human operators have read-only roles. Audit logging ships to the Fenholt aggregator with a 90-day retention window. For your review, the full runtime configuration as deployed follows below.

deployment values, hawip-kajef:
[istiel]
port = 6379
team = praion
host = istiel.zarqelsys.local
region = north-1
access_code = ac_113c3d
timeout_ms = 500

Handover note — Crumbwheel order cutoffs.

Welcome aboard. The bakery cutoff rule in Crumbwheel closes same-day orders at 14:00 local to each storefront, not UTC — this has bitten us twice. Holiday overrides live in the calendar service and take precedence silently, so always check there first when a cutoff looks wrong. To unlock the calendar service's admin console after a restart, enter the recovery passphrase below.

vault phrase of bagap-bahaf = silion-pelox-sorox-casdor-quenwyn-fraax-eliox-praael-kelion-quenvan-kasox-rusael-norius-belvan

Reviewer: confirm the new circuit breaker around the Meridex pricing API trips after five consecutive failures within 30 seconds, holds open for 60 seconds, and half-opens with a single probe request. Verify that open-state responses serve the cached price table rather than erroring, and that breaker state changes emit metrics under the `upstream.meridex` namespace. Also check the integration test covers the half-open probe failing twice in a row. Record your approval against the candidate's build token below.

session token of tajef-bageg = htk21_5d90d574934f3ccae6437

- [ ] Quarterly stock-count ledger: collect the bound ledger from the Marwick Supply back office before the 14:00 run to the Hollowbrook depot. Confirm all four quarterly tabs are signed off by the count supervisor and that the cover seal is intact. Log the pick-up in the off-site register and note the seal number on the run sheet. Do not leave the ledger unattended in the vehicle at any stop. The courier hand-over instruction for this item follows below.

courier memo of yahif-faweg: the quenael tamius courier leaves the prawyn jorix kaswyn istox silmir brieth zormir fenvan ledger at gate 3145 under passcode 231062